Delhi to Jeddah by Air freight
The quickest way to get from Delhi to Jeddah by plane will take about 5h 47m and departs from Indira Gandhi International Airport (DEL) and arrives into King Abdulaziz International Airport (JED). There are flights departing 2-4 times a day on this route. Saudia is one of the carriers that operates regular services on this route with flights departing every 1-2 days.

More about shipping cargo and freight from Delhi to Jeddah by Air, Ocean and Road
The shortest shipping time by sea between Delhi and Jeddah is 6 days 5h. Ships depart from Mundra (INMUN) and arrive at Jeddah (SAJED) with scheduled departures Every 1-2 days.
There are scheduled container ships that depart every 1-2 days from Mundra (INMUN) and arrive into Jeddah (SAJED) around 6 days 5h later. The quickest flight from Delhi to Jeddah takes around 5h 47m. Flights depart from Indira Gandhi International Airport (DEL) and arrive at King Abdulaziz International Airport (JED).
Scheduled flights between Indira Gandhi International Airport (DEL) and King Abdulaziz International Airport (JED) depart 2-4 times a day. No, it doesn't look like there are dedicated Cargo planes flying between Delhi and Jeddah. There are regular passenger aircraft however and they might be able to accommodate your cargo depending on its dimensions and weight.
The distance between Delhi and Jeddah by cargo ship is 2,266 Nautical Miles (4,196 Kilometres / 2,607 Miles). This distance is measured by sea between Mundra (INMUN) and Jeddah (SAJED).
The distance between Delhi and Jeddah by air is around 3,883 Kilometres (2,413 Miles). This distance is measured following typical flight paths between Indira Gandhi International Airport (DEL) and King Abdulaziz International Airport (JED).
307kg CO₂e (per TEU) is the estimated emissions output (CO2e) when transporting a typical shipping container (1 TEU) from Delhi to Jeddah. This is calculated using the overall historical emissions of the average container ship on this trade lane and dividing it by the total projected capacity.
264kg CO₂e (per 100kg) is the estimated emissions output (CO2e) when sending cargo by air from Delhi to Jeddah. This is calculated by determining the total fuel burn output of various aircraft that typically fly this route and dividing it by the total available cargo capacity in KGs.
